CLINTON TOWNSHIP, MI – The Madonna University men's bowling team traveled to Imperial Lanes this past weekend, October 4th and 5th, to compete in the 54th Annual Brunswick Midwest Collegiate Championship
. In a Tier 1 field featuring top-tier programs, the Crusaders demonstrated consistent performance across the individual standings.
Leading the way for Madonna was Dylan Jablonski, who secured a top-20 finish in the individual combined scores
. Jablonski found his rhythm in the third game, posting a stellar 246, which helped propel him to the 20th spot in a massive field of bowlers
.
The Crusaders also saw solid contributions from Brandon Leavitt, who finished 55th overall
. Leavitt remained remarkably consistent throughout the four-game block, highlighted by a strong opening game of 210. Not far behind was Keith McLeod, who earned the 75th rank
. McLeod finished his weekend on a high note, firing a team-high 236 in his final game of the block
.
Rounding out the notable individual performances for the Crusaders was Jonathon Michalski, who finished 160th
. Michalski stayed steady through his rotation, including a high game of 202 during his second round
.
Competing in one of the premier Tier 1 events of the season, the Crusaders faced off against a deep field including eventual individual leader Dawson Peterson from the University of Wisconsin-Whitewater and runner-up Jacob Lehn of Muskingum University.
